Fish Report for 9-11-2013

"Nice six-day," reported Vagabond September 9. "We saw wide-open school fishing. Good pick on bluefin tuna up to 89 pounds, yellowfin tuna to 36 l pounds, yellowtail up to 38 pounds, Dorado for color, and even a few stories of giant bluefin. Good weather."
Jackpot winners were:
Bruce Essex with an 89.4-pound bluefin
2nd place to Byron Cloar with a 72.8-pounder
3rd place: Brent Wolf was right behind with a 72-pounder
